Q: I need some tips and tricks for quick changes. Whattya got?
Elphaba: Hi! If you have a dresser make sure they actually HELP you. Most of the time they will, but make sure they have your costumes ready before you are even offstage, ESPECIALLY if it's a very quick change. This will help you enormously as you can do other things (like shoes, accessories etc) whilst they button or zip you up. If you don't have a dresser make sure you have all your costumes in order and hung up neatly. Maybe get you next costume ready before you go onstage so you can just grab it. If your costume is difficult to get on ask someone who is not doing anything at the moment like an ensemble member or a stagehand or just a another cast member who isn't changing themselves. If it's not that quick of a change help each other out. Hope I could help!
